Since 1982, OWASA has co-sponsored more than 75 drives with donations totaling nearly 4,000 units of blood to benefit almost 12,000 people. However, current blood supplies are low and donations are crucial for helping people undergoing surgery, people who are injured and suffer blood loss, etc. Jeff Davis, Donor Recruitment Representative with the American Red Cross, said “Blood types O-, O+ and A- are currently at critically low levels. Although about 60% of Americans are eligible to give blood, only 5% regularly donate. This situation worsens dramatically during summer months when many regular donors, such as high school students, college students and business professionals, take vacations. Since our only source of blood is volunteer donors, the gap between donations and hospital demand grows at an alarming rate from May to September. The result is a serious and very real blood shortage.” Anna Maria’s, Whole Foods Market-Chapel Hill and OWASA will provide food for the blood drive.
